Sacred Heart School, founded in 1947, provides a Catholic environment dedciated to devloping young people whose actions reflect knowledge, respect and integrity. Our students live in 3 states and 6 counties. Many students come from twenty-four different countries.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does Sacred Heart School cost?
Sacred Heart School's tuition is approximately $3,798 for private students.
What schools are Sacred Heart School often compared to?
Sacred Heart School is often viewed alongside schools like Northpoint Christian School by visitors of our site.
What is the acceptance rate of Sacred Heart School?
The acceptance rate of Sacred Heart School is 85%, which is lower than the national average of 88%. Sacred Heart School's acceptance rate is ranked among the top private schools in Mississippi with low acceptance rates.
What sports does Sacred Heart School offer?
Sacred Heart School offers 6 interscholastic sports: Basketball, Cheering, Cross Country, Golf, Soccer and Volleyball.
What is Sacred Heart School's ranking?
Sacred Heart School ranks among the top 20% of private schools in Mississippi for: Least expensive tuition, Lowest average acceptance rates and Oldest founding date.
When is the application deadline for Sacred Heart School?
The application deadline for Sacred Heart School is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
